Idrissou Moustapha Agnidé (born 31 December 1981 in Ifangni) is a Beninese football player who plays for Stade Quimpérois.

Agnidé previously played several seasons for AS Vitré in the Championnat de France amateur.

He played for the Benin national football team at the 2004 African Cup of Nations.
